In my estimation and based on my personal experiences, people either love or hate the 90s metal band Pantera.

If you’re in the latter group and enjoy the melodies and biting guitar riffs of the late Dimebag Darrell, you should be pleased to learn Pantera’s 1996 The Great Southern Trendkill is coming to the world of Rock Band next week.

Each song is $2/160 MS Points/200 Wii Points or $15.99/1280 MS Points for the entire pack (not available for Wii).

Available on Xbox 360, Wii and PlayStation 3 system (May 25):

· "The Great Southern Trendkill"

· "War Nerve"

· "Drag the Waters"

· "10’s"

· "13 Steps to Nowhere"

· "Suicide Note Pt. II"

· "Living Through Me (Hell’s Wrath)

· "Floods"

· "The Underground in America"

· "(Reprise) Sandblasted Skin"

(All tracks are original master recordings; "Suicide Note Pt. I" is not included in this pack.)

(These tracks will be available in Europe on PlayStation 3 May 26)

Harmonix made no mention in the release if these songs will also be available in the kid friendly LEGO: Rock Band music store, but, being Pantera, we wouldn’t expect to see them there anyway.
